Output c3b800fcf34026ad6b52ed381a648f0baa079665fedbc267a549e7ba2f997a2a:18

value
2066159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15a21b049482705db1cc21b6a8350302f32431fa OP_EQUAL
address
33fQJryd3m6bqjeA6KwQzie6pNwwyn6tfd
transaction
c3b800fcf34026ad6b52ed381a648f0baa079665fedbc267a549e7ba2f997a2a
confirmations
127037
spent
true